- Temporary Total Disablement: Complete inability to work due to accidental injury for a limited, recoverable period
- Temporary Disability Insurance: Cover that pays periodic benefits if an accident temporarily prevents you from working
- Life Assured: The individual whose life or health risk is covered under the insurance policy
- Sum Insured: The maximum amount payable by the insurer under a specific cover or benefit
- Permanent Total Disability: Irreversible disability that completely prevents the insured from working for life
